Output 1869d205541ea346a3005dfcf3e3039817acd9c5ded64056fcae23bc6c4e7af6:1

value
4890288421
script pubkey
OP_0 OP_PUSHBYTES_20 83e9fbf0efd632277d6e9c89bdc527bf57c15677
address
tb1qs05lhu806cezwltwnjymm3f8hatuz4nhk3j39d
transaction
1869d205541ea346a3005dfcf3e3039817acd9c5ded64056fcae23bc6c4e7af6
confirmations
55824
spent
true